5D Mark II THM files

Is there any way to get Bridge to recognize THM files as the JPG source of EXIF information for the 5D Mark II's MOV files?  And, on that note, is there any way to get Bridge to manage the "sidecar" nature of these files (meaning, if you rename or copy the MOV, the THM is also renamed or copied).
I have a command-line batch file for renaming all THM files in a folder to JPG, but it would be so much more convenient if Bridge just treated the THM files in the same manner as it handles XMP files associated with the CR2 files...I frequently forget to copy THM files with my MOVs since I work in Bridge so much (where THM files are hidden).

The .THM file isn't associated with the video file in Bridge CS5. You have to remember to 'Show Hidden Files' before you want to rename/move the video files together with the .THM files.

  • Canon 5D mark II raw file conversion size blowout

    I am suffering from an issue where my CR2 files from a 5D decrease in size when converted to DNG  from for example 14.4MB to 11.8MB while the 5D mark II files increase from 8.7MB to a much larger 23.6MB after conversion. Both conversions are being done with DNG Converter 5.4 using the same preferences. Any light you could shine on this for me would be greatly appreciated.

    It is because your 5D Mark II files are sRAW images, not raw. (The full 5D Mark II raw files are usually over 20 MB, not ~8 MB.) When you process sRAW files into DNG files, the DNG files are stored in the "linear DNG" format, which is much bigger than the sRAW format.

  • What does a question mark and i file mean on my macbook pro

    what does a question mark and i file mean on my macbook pro when i turn it on?

    To be more specific, the computer is not finding a valid system when it starts up. This may result from the hard drive's physical mechanism failing, or the system on the drive being corrupted in some way.
    Repairing permissions is not likely to fix this issue. Instead I would suggest booting from the system install DVD, running Disk Utility, selecting your hard drive's partition and select *Repair Disk*.
    Note: if the hard drive does not show up in Disk Utility at all, it is dead and will need to be replaced. Contact Apple (800-275-2273 in the USA) and have them set up warranty service, or carry the MacBook in to an Apple retail store to have it fixed. Be sure to [make an appointment|http://www.apple.com/retail] first you you may wait a long time to speak to a Mac Genius.
    If Repair Disk finds any problems and is able to correct them, you may be able to restart and everything be okay. If it is unable to correct the problems, you will need to erase and restore your hard drive.
    If Repair Disk does not find any problems, I would suggest an Archive and Install as described in [this article|http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1710].

  • How To Import .THM Files Into Premiere Pro CS5

    Hello:
    I just purchased a Canon Vixia HFM50.  When I use the presets, there is support for the AVCHD format.  The file extension for the AVCHD format from the Canon is *.THM.  Yet, that file type is not recognized.  How do I import it?
    Regards,
    Rich Locus

    Hi Rich Locus,
    Thanks for your post.  THM is an image file format for thumbnails. Images are made smaller for browsing purposes, usually because it is easier to view and takes less time to load.
    THM files can be viewed by most image preview or editing programs on both Macs and PCs. THM files are similar to .JPEG files, and those .
    THM files representing image files can usually be converted to JPEG format by changing the name of the file from .THM to .JPEG or .JPG.
    THM files can also be used by videos. When extracting a video file from a camcorder, a thumbnail will be created to represent the video, usually taken from the video’s first frame.
    The .THM file will then have the same name as the .AVI file that it represents. With Canon-created video files, the .THM file also contains the metadata for the video, and therefore needs to remain with and have the same name as the .AVI file.
